Flat Roof Replacement cost by efficiency in Oxford Circle
Flat roofs are defined by their membrane. EPDM (rubber) is the budget standard; TPO is the popular reflective 'cool roof' choice; PVC and modified bitumen suit grease or high-traffic settings.
| EPDM rubber membraneLowest-cost; durable black rubber; ~20–25 yr | $5,650 – $12,100 |
| TPO (reflective single-ply)Energy-saving white 'cool roof'; the mainstream pick | $6,700 – $14,250 |
| PVC / modified bitumenBest for chemical/grease exposure or layered systems | $7,800 – $16,400 |

Additional flat roof replacement costs to budget for
These aren't always in the headline price. Whether you'll pay them depends on your home's condition and setup.
| Tear-off & disposal of old membrane | $1,000 – $3,000 |
| Decking / substrate repairFlat roofs trap water, so rot is common | $500 – $3,000 |
| New rigid insulation board (R-value) | $1,000 – $4,000 |
| Drains, scuppers & tapered slope correctionTo stop standing water (ponding) | $500 – $3,000 |
| Flashing & parapet wall detailing | $400 – $2,000 |
| Permit | $150 – $500 |
Typical national add-on ranges; confirm locally during your quote.

How long does flat roof replacement last in Oxford Circle?
EPDM and TPO last ~20–25 years; PVC up to 30. Standing water shortens any flat-roof membrane.
Twice-yearly inspections to clear drains, reseal seams, and catch ponding before it causes leaks.
Signs you need flat roof replacement in Oxford Circle
- Standing water (ponding) that lingers more than 48 hours after rain
- Blisters, bubbles, or splits in the membrane
- Seams or flashing lifting, cracking, or pulling apart
- Interior water stains, drips, or a sagging deck
- The membrane is brittle, cracked, or shrinking with age
- Repeated patch repairs that no longer hold
Repair or replace in Oxford Circle?
Repair if…
- Leaks trace to isolated seams, flashing, or a single puncture
- The membrane is under ~15 years old and otherwise sound
- A reflective recoat can extend the existing membrane's life
Replace if…
- The membrane is brittle, blistered, or splitting across the roof
- Chronic ponding has saturated the insulation or decking
- The roof is past 20 years and leaking in multiple spots

Why flat roof replacement quotes vary — and how to compare them fairly
Two bids for the “same” job can differ by thousands. Usually it's scope, not greed — here's what moves the number and how to get an apples-to-apples comparison.
Why a quote looks high (or low)
- A storm-chaser's lowball often skips flashing, ice-and-water shield or a real warranty.
- Deck repair, underlayment grade and ventilation may or may not be in the price.
- Shingle tier (3-tab vs. architectural vs. premium) changes both material and labor.
Get an apples-to-apples bid
- Confirm underlayment, ice-and-water shield, flashing and ventilation are included.
- Compare the workmanship warranty, not just the material warranty.
- Ask how deck/sheathing repairs are priced if rot is found.
- Verify the contractor is licensed, insured and local, with recent references.
